Comprehending Car Locksmith Services
A car locksmith is a customized professional trained to handle all aspects of automotive lock and key issues. These experts are equipped with the understanding and tools to assist with a range of issues, including:
Key Extraction: Retrieving keys that are stuck in the ignition or door lock.Key Duplication: Making copies of your existing car keys.Lockout Assistance: Gaining entry to your vehicle when you are locked out.Key Programming: Programming brand-new keys for contemporary automobiles with transponder chips.Lock Replacement: Replacing damaged or defective locks.Ignition Repair: Fixing problems with the ignition system.When to Call a Car Locksmith

Q: Can a car locksmith make a new key if I don't have any existing keys?

A: Yes, a professional car locksmith can produce a new key even if you don't have any existing keys. They will need the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) and may require evidence of ownership to comply with security guidelines.

Q: How long does it consider a car locksmith to get here?

A: The action time can differ depending on the locksmith's availability and your location. Numerous locksmiths use rapid reaction services and can show up within 30 minutes to an hour. Sometimes, it may take longer throughout peak hours.

Q: Will the locksmith damage my car while gaining entry?

A: A credible car locksmith will use non-invasive strategies to acquire entry to your vehicle. However, in some cases, minor damage may occur, specifically if the lock is particularly stubborn. The locksmith must inform you if this is a possibility.

Q: Can I get a car locksmith if I have a blowout or other non-lock-related concerns?

A: Car locksmith professionals specialize in lock and key services. If you have a flat tire or other mechanical concerns, you ought to call a tow truck or a mechanic. However, some locksmiths may provide extra services, so it's worth asking.

Q: Is it legal for a car locksmith to make a copy of my key?

A: Yes, it is legal for a car locksmith to make a copy of your key, offered they have your permission and you can prove ownership of the vehicle.
